Kakinada: Medical representatives, who hold allegiance to AP Medical and sales representatives union, staged demonstration near the Collectorate here on Monday, demanding strict implementation of Sales Promotion Employees Act and waiver of GST on medicines and medical equipment besides stoppage of online sale of medicines.

Union state treasurer Dumpala Prasad while addressing the protesters demanded that the government formulate specific working rules to the medical representatives and enhancement of TA and DA which is proportionate to the rising prices.
He also demanded the scraping of four labour codes recently brought out by government in support of managements. He also released a poster listing out the demands charter and in support of the proposed countrywide strike on January 19.
Union state committee members D Venkanna, Kakinada city committee secretary ARC Varma, Treasurer Krishna, CITU city unit president Palivela Virababu have led the stir.
